Riverside Lyric Opera Brings Live Opera Back to Temecula in Addition to its Riverside Productions!

Temecula, CA – Riverside Lyric Opera opens its 2013-14 season with three performances of “Amahl and the Night Visitors” by Gian Carlo Menotti, directed by Cynthia Leigh. Under the musical direction of Dr. Stephen Tucker from UC Irvine, the opera, in English, features a cast of seasoned professional opera singers accompanied by a live orchestra.

Principal roles are played by Luke Larson (Amahl), Cynthia Leigh (the Mother), Mario Rios (King Kaspar), John Hansen (King Melchior), Terry Welborn (King Balthazer) and James Cameron (the Page). Additional cast members include a chorus of shepherds. Menotti’s music is delightful with a plot line that features a crippled shepherd boy and his mother who witness a miracle when visited by the three Wise Men on their way to Bethlehem. This is a Christmas classic the whole family can enjoy. Artist bios and photos are available upon request.

Performances are slated for Saturday, Dec. 28th at 2 pm and 7 pm at St. Thomas Episcopal Church, 44651 Avenida de Missiones, Temecula, CA 92592 and again on Sunday, Dec. 29th at 4 pm at The Box, Fox Entertainment Plaza, 3635 Market St., Riverside, CA 92501.

About Riverside Lyric Opera: Riverside Lyric Opera, now in its 11th season, is a Riverside based, professional regional opera company whose mission is to enrich lives through music, community development and educational programs that involve the Inland Empire communities in all aspects of the art.
